5th Annual Prayer Vigil for the Canadian Forces - Sat, Jan 29th

The Military Christian Fellowship of Canada and the National House of Prayer invite all Canadians to stand together in prayer across the country this Saturday, January 29th for the 5th Annual National Prayer Vigil for the Canadian Forces.
 
This is not a political event. 

Since 2001, the men and women of the Canadian Forces have been at war. They have offered themselves in the service of their country, at the direction of our leaders, in Afghanistan and around the world.  More than 150 men and women have given their lives, and many more have come home grievously injured. They need our prayer.
 
This Saturday, people will gather in their homes, at churches, armouries or wherever decided, to lift up our military and their families in prayer. In Ottawa, people will gather to pray in front of the Centennial Flame on Parliament Hill at 4 pm EST.

If your group will gather to pray, please send a brief email to the Military Christian Fellowship regarding your event (for email: click here).

MCF's List of prayer items for the Prayer Vigil
:
1.  Pray for the progression of the plan for Canadian soldiers to leave the South of Afghanistan.  Canada has been involved in the reconstruction of the Dhala Dam (Dhala means Harvest) that would allow Afghanistan to have water that would bring a harvest of produce to feed their nation rather than poppies that need very little water.  We have also been involved in reconstructing their main road and in rebuilding 50 schools that allow children to attend school.  Please pray that all that was reconstructed will be protected from attacks of the enemy and that the Afghani people will be able to govern their own country and enjoy peace and security.

2.  Pray that the Canadian Forces will be effective in training the Afghanis. That the Canadian soldiers will understand what they have to do and would not feel they are running away before the job is ended.  Pray that Canada will finish its mission well.

3. Pray for the current rotation of the 22nd Regiment based in Valcartier, Quebec (they are called the Van Doos).

4. Pray for strength and courage in those who command troops at all levels, pray for a Joshua type of anointing on all our troops.  Joshua 1:6; be strong and courageous, because you will lead these people to inherit the land I swore to their ancestors to give them.
